Apple iPhone SE (3rd Gen) vs Nokia XR21 5G

The Apple iPhone SE (3rd Gen) is the budget option here, offering a compact design and a powerful A15 chip. However, if you're after durability and better specs for daily use, the Nokia XR21 5G stands out with its impressive features. The Nokia brings a 6.49-inch display that’s perfect for streaming and gaming, while the iPhone SE's 4.7-inch screen feels cramped in comparison. Key specs: Display: 4.7" vs 6.49" and Refresh: 60 Hz vs 120 Hz.

Who should buy each?

Choose the Apple iPhone SE (3rd Gen) if: you want a lightweight phone at 5.09oz, prefer a classic design with Touch ID, or need a solid introduction to the iPhone ecosystem.
Choose the Nokia XR21 5G if: you need a durable phone with IP69K rating, want a larger 6.49" display for gaming, or need a longer-lasting 4800mAh battery.
